Definitions:

Hernia

A medical condition where an organ or fatty tissue squeezes through a weak spot in the surrounding muscle or connective tissue.

Abdominal Muscles

A group of muscles located in the abdomen that supports the trunk, allows movement and holds organs in place by regulating internal abdominal pressure.

Bowel Protruding

A medical condition where part of the intestine bulges through a weakened area of the abdominal wall.

Umbilical Cord

The flexible cordlike structure connecting a fetus in the womb to the placenta, transporting nutrients and oxygen from the mother and removing waste products.
